М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
9uh9ev2
9uh9ev2
08.05.2022 16:57 •  Информатика

Известны результаты теста по информатике ( от 0 до 22). отметка "3" ставиться если было получено от 5 до 11 , "4" - от 12 до 17 и 5 - от 18 и выше, "2" - меньше 5 . определить отметку ученика по его полученным ? оформление сложного условия: и(условие1; условие2; или (условие1; условие1;

👇
Ответ:
iYaw999
iYaw999
08.05.2022
Решение задачи в Excel - в прилагаемом файле.
Формула:
=ЕСЛИ(C2>=18;5;ЕСЛИ(C2>=12;4;ЕСЛИ(C2>=5;3;2)))
Замечание: в сложных условиях здесь нет необходимости. Лучше использовать вложенные "ЕСЛИ".
4,6(97 оценок)
Ответ:
Hamidylla
Hamidylla
08.05.2022
def chislo(a):
if (a<= 22):
if ( a >=5) and ( a <=11):
print("Ваша оценка 3")
elif ( a > 12) and ( a <= 17):
print("Ваша оценка 4")
elif ( a >= 18 ) and ( a <=22):
print("Ваша оценка 5")
elif(a <5) and ( a >=0):
print("Ваша оценка 2")
else:
print(False)
a = int(input("a = "))
chislo(a)
Известны результаты теста по информатике ( от 0 до 22). отметка 3 ставиться если было получено от
4,8(82 оценок)
Открыть все ответы
Ответ:
likaKiss1
likaKiss1
08.05.2022

ответ:var err, right, answer : integer;

BEGIN

err := 0; right := 0;

writeLn('Сейчас Вам будет предложен тест по архитектуре. ');

writeLn('К каждому вопросу три варианта ответа. ');

writeLn('Вы должны ввести номер правильного ответа и нажать <Еnter>');

writeLn;

writeLn('Архитектор Исаакиевского собора: ');

writeLn('1. Доменико Трезини');

writeLn('2. Огюст Монферран');

writeLn('3. Карл Росси');

Write('Ваш ответ: ');ReadLn(answer);

if answer = 2 then begin

WriteLn('Правильно');

right := right +1;

end

else begin

WriteLn('Неправильно');

err := err + 1;

end;

writeLn;

writeLn('Архитектор Зимнего дворца: ');

writeLn('1. Франческо Бартоломео');

writeLn('2. Карл Росси');

writeLn('3. Огюст Монферран');

Write('Ваш ответ: ');ReadLn(answer);

if answer = 2 then begin

WriteLn('Правильно');

right := right +1;

end

else begin

WriteLn('Неправильно');

err := err + 1;

end;

writeLn;

writeLn('Невский проспект получил свое название: ');

writeLn('1. По имени реки, на которой стоит Санк-Петербург');

writeLn('2. По имени близко расположенной Александро-Невской лавры');

writeLn('3. В память о знаменитом полководце - Александре Невском');

Write('Ваш ответ: ');ReadLn(answer);

if answer = 2 then begin

WriteLn('Правильно');

right := right +1;

end

else begin

WriteLn('Неправильно');

err := err + 1;

end;

WriteLn('Правильных ответов: ', right);

WriteLn('Неправильных ответов: ', err);

END.

Объяснение:

P.S. Это конечно не то,но думаю по аналогию сможешь составить

4,6(42 оценок)
Ответ:
Den1ska4
Den1ska4
08.05.2022

Решил сделать так. Можно написать через For

var

a,b,c:integer;

begin

 repeat

   readln(a,b);

 until (a<100) and (b<100);

 if a>b then

   begin

     c:=a;

     a:=b;

     b:=c;

   end;

 if a mod 9 <> 0 then

   begin

     inc(a);

     while (a mod 9 <> 0) do

        inc(a);

     while a<=b do

       begin

         writeln(a,'^3 = ',a*a*a);

         a:=a+9;

       end;

   end

     else

       while a<=b do

         begin

           writeln(a,'^3 = ',a*a*a);

           a:=a+9;

         end;        

end.

4,6(49 оценок)
Это интересно:
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